Luo Huining, male, Han nationality, is a native of Yiwu City of Zhejiang Province. He was born in 1954, started to work in 1970 and joined CPC in 1982. From 1999 to 2002, Luo studied at Business School of Chinese University of Science and Technology and earned his master degree in management Science and engineering. From 2000 to 2003, he studied at Economics College of People’s University of China and earned his doctorate degree in Economics.
Luo served as Deputy Secretary of CPC Provincial Committee of Qinghai Province from 2003-2009 and President of Party School of CPC Provincial Committee of Qinghai Province from 2004-2009. He was also a delegate of 16th CPC Congress. He was an Alternate Member of 17th CPC Central Committee and a delegate of 17th CPC National Congress. He served as governor of Qinghai Province from 2010 to 2013. He is now a Member of the 18th CPC Central Committee, Secretary of the CPC Qinghai Provincial Committee and Director of the Standing Committee of the Qinghai Provincial People's Congress.
